Pros and Cons of Buying a 1969 SB Chevy 350 Engine Block (4.060 A-9-9)

I. Introduction

The 1969 SB Chevy 350 engine block, specifically referred to as the 4.060 A-9-9, is a popular choice for classic car enthusiasts and hot rod builders due to its durability, power, and availability. However, potential buyers should weigh the pros and cons before making a purchase decision.

II. Pros

1. Widespread Availability: The 350 engine block is one of the most common engines produced by General Motors during the muscle car era. This means parts are readily available, and the engine can be customized with aftermarket components.

2. Power: The 350 engine delivers a good balance of power and reliability. Out of the box, it produces around 270 horsepower and 325 lb-ft of torque. With the addition of performance parts, it can easily exceed 400 horsepower.

3. Cost-Effective: Compared to other high-performance engines, the 350 engine is relatively affordable. This makes it an excellent choice for those looking to build a budget hot rod or classic car.

III. Cons

1. Emissions Regulations: Older engines like the 1969 SB Chevy 350 may not meet modern emissions standards. This could limit the ability to register the vehicle or require modifications, adding additional costs.

2. Wear and Tear: An engine block date-stamped as 1969 has undergone several thousand miles of usage during its lifetime. Reconditioning and replacing parts may be necessary to ensure reliability and longevity.

3. Maintenance: Older engines can be more labor-intensive and time-consuming to maintain compared to modern engines. This may be a deterrent for those who lack mechanical knowledge or access to the appropriate tools.

IV. Conclusion

The 1969 SB Chevy 350 engine block (4.060 A-9-9) offers a unique combination of power, affordability, and availability that makes it an attractive option for many projects. However, potential buyers should consider the cons, such as the need for emissions compliance, wear and tear, and maintenance, before making a purchase decision.
